Experts from the Industry and European Parliament will present their views on the necessary political support and investments for frictionless transport in Europe. Road transport was, is and remains the cornerstone for transporting goods in Europe. Besides a road infrastructure that is capable of coping with the amount of goods to be transported, the regulations concerning international cross-border activities are crucial and have a major impact on the effectiveness and efficiency of transport, but also on the evolution of the industry supply chains and transport sector.

How will the European Union strengthen and expand its infrastructure and connections with other continents, while combining ecology with economy? How can the EU create a framework in which the entire supply chain can stay competitive through innovation, powered by long term secured financing? How do you remedy the growing lack of skilled cross-border workforce and drivers? These questions and many other subjects will be addressed by the UECC during the conference and in their position paper to be released and ahead of the European Parliament elections of May 2019.
